Glen Lake pairs neighborhood calm with easy access to the best of Loveland. Residents enjoy quick connections to the riverfront, where the Little Miami flows past Historic Downtown and the paved corridor of Little Miami State Park welcomes cyclists, runners, and families out for a breezy stroll. Weekends often include picnics at Nisbet Park, a tour of medieval curiosities at Loveland Castle, or a relaxed afternoon of fishing and paddle craft at Lake Isabella.
Families value the area’s strong schooling options through Loveland City Schools, known for robust academics, arts, and athletics that build community pride. Tree-lined streets, well-kept yards, and friendly block gatherings make it easy to settle in, while nearby dining along the riverfront offers everything from casual patios to date-night spots after a day on the trail.
Commuters appreciate straightforward drives to major employment hubs in Cincinnati, with additional shopping and entertainment close by in Mason and Milford. Outdoor enthusiasts can launch kayaks, log training miles, or simply watch the sunset reflect on the water—then be home in minutes.
